sir we have done work on mine site and we paid money to mine owner for his business by RTGs and few amount by cash .there were some disputs amoung us hence we filed suit in court against him .Then we compromise with him and we made agreement with him and same is submitted in court to withdraw suit.he gave 5 cheques against work and refund of money as per agreement.two cheques were cleared now 3rd 1nd fouth cheques are bounced. 1)what legal action to be taken. 2)can he raise any query regardind payments, as he signed the account settaled and accepted by him and signed.

Have U Present the Cheque within three months from the issuing date? if yes, then give a legal notice to him within one month from the date of cheque bounce. If he will not return the money to you, within 15 days from the date of receiving notice. Then you can put the case under NI act sec. 138.
